[Announcement of MOE] Guide on registration applications for existing chemical substances.
When applying for registration in accordance with K-REACH Enforcement Decree Article 13 Subparagraph 1-3, the leader must check the joint registrants’ compliance to the relevant conditions(details of pre-registration or altered notification, whether the chemical is for general consumer use) before submission. .
* Article 13 of the Enforcement Decree for K-REACH(Omission of Submission Data when Applying for Chemical Substance Registration), Subparagraph 1-3: Existing chemical substances whose submitted data for substance registration, etc. contain health hazard or environmental hazard categories which meet the standards as set by decree of the Ministry of Environment(cases where the chemical is manufactured/imported for consumer use are excluded.
